That normally comes to about 1.five teaspoons of loose leaves per 6 ounces of water.Temperature is essential, and must be calibrated depending on the type of tea you are brewing. Most herbal and black teas require to be brewed in water that is among 205 and 212 degrees Fahrenheit (96C-100C). Black varieties contact for about three-five minutes of steeping time, while the herbals generally need about 5 to 7 minutes. Oolongs and green teas, as a rule of thumb, should be steeped for 3-five minutes, but white tea needs only 2 or 3 minutes in the hot water. Here are the recommended temperatures for oolong, green and white tea: Oolong 185F (85C) to 200F (95C), green, 165F (75C) to185F (85C), and white, 160F (70C) to175F (80C).A number of substances in the leaf contribute to the flavor here. and aroma of green tea. The overall flavor and read more sweetness of green tea is determined by a selection of amino acids and organic sugars. Bitterness and astringency are contributed by polyphenols ("tannins"). Amino acids dissolve at 140°F (60 °C) while tannins dissolve at 176°F (80°C).
